What they do
An Inventory Associate monitors warehouse inventory and places orders with vendors for supplies. Conducts regular or occasional audits of inventory or sections of a warehouse.

IN A RECEIVING DEPARTMENT ASSOCIATE JOB, YOU'LL BE RESPONSIBLE FOR
- Receiving and inspecting inbound shipments for accuracy and damage.
- Verifying quantities, part numbers, and shipment documentation against purchase orders and packing slips.
- Operating reach truck, stand-up, and sit-down forklifts to unload, transport, and store materials safely.
- Performing cycle counts and assisting with inventory control to maintain accurate stock levels.
- Using RF scanners and computer systems to receive inventory and update warehouse records.
- Entering and maintaining accurate inventory data using Microsoft Office applications and warehouse management systems.
- Understanding and accurately working with units of measure (UOM), including cases, reaches, dozens, cartons, and pallets.
- Maintaining a clean, organized, and safe receiving area while following company safety procedures.
- Working closely with warehouse and production teams to ensure timely material flow.
